,: With his second Origin release, Jared Hall directs his attention :,
: to the influences that first kindled and then nourished and :
:' sustained his life path as a trumpeter/composer. Thoughts of ':
,: Woody Shaw, Tom Harrell, Wallace Roney and others provided the :,
: inspiration for the eight original compositions, along with Gigi :
:' Gryce's "Minority," while their adventurous spirits, technical ':
,: brilliance and commitment to a voice infuse the performances by :,
: Hall's quartet. Miami-based, Grammy-winning pianist Tal Cohen's :
:' exhilarating interplay along with the dynamic lift from ':
,: Seattle's Michael Glynn on bass and drummer John Bishop launches :,
: "Song for Shaw" with a '70's momentum. They deliver an expansive :
:' warmth on "Dear Roy" for Hall to reflect on Roy Hargrove ':
,: within, and the tribute to his main mentor Brian Lynch, :,
: "Professor B.L.," is imbued with a Latin-tinged fire. :

,: Influences is a collection of compositions, many of which are :,
: dedicated to influential and innovative jazz trumpeters, all :
:' written after the release of my album Seen on the Scene (Origin ':
,: Records) from 2018 to early 2021. A few selections have been :,
: performed live for years, while others make their debut here. :
:' Each tune is deeply personal, as the names mentioned below have ':
,: been critical to my personal development as a performer, :,
: educator, and composer. :
:' ':
,: Song for Shaw is dedicated to the late trumpeter Woody Shaw. His :,
: angular sense of melody balanced with contrasting harmonic :
:' twists and turns was always intriguing to me. This composition ':
,: aims to capture Shaw s adventurous spirit and technical :,
: precision. :
:' ':
,: Losing Roy Hargrove was a devastating loss for the jazz :,
: community and New York music scene, especially at the age of 49 :
:' felt far too early. Dear Roy serves as a love letter to the ':
,: soulful and lyrical side of Hargrove, often found in his ballad :,
: and flugelhorn performance. :
:' ':
,: Professor B.L. is a tribute to virtuoso trumpeter Brian Lynch, :,
: who takes his teaching as serious as his artistry. Having been :
:' fortunate to study and work with him for many years, his ':
,: process was perhaps his greatest influence on my performance and :,
: pedagogy as a musician. :
:' ':
,: Another recent tragic loss was trumpeter Wallace Roney, passing :,
: from complications of coronavirus in March 2020. Wallace truly :
:' encompassed the sound, harmonic ideas, and rhythmic ':
,: sensibilities of Miles Davis, all while having a unique :,
: impression on the music and adding to the lineage of outstanding :
:' jazz trumpeters. One for Wallace is a tune in his memory. ':
,: :,
: Let The Children Dance was one of many compositions written :
:' during my two-year residency at the historic Tula s Jazz Club ':
,: in Seattle, Washington. Having a young son of my own, this song :,
: is meant to embody the imagery of children playing, singing, and :
:' dancing where they express their limitless joy and innocence. ':
,: :,
: Beyond The Thorns musically describes moving through the harsh :
:' experiences many have in this life. If you live long enough, ':
,: every person will encounter hardships and vices in their life :,
: which attempt to destroy them, and at times, succeed. This tune :
:' expresses the journey of moving beyond the pain, tending to the ':
,: scrapes, and surviving scars to find peace and contentment. :,
: :
:' I met one of my musical heroes, trumpeter and composer Tom ':
,: Harrell, in the lobby of a hotel. The humility and sincerity :,
: found in the conversation of such a melodic genius was unlike :
:' anything I had experienced before. Harrell is composed in ':
,: homage to his artistry and musical perseverance. :,
: :
:' The lyrical beauty and seemingly endless melodic lines of ':
,: Clifford Brown are found on a gem of a recording, The Complete :,
: Paris Sessions, Volume 2. Brown s technical prowess and ease :
:' across the range of the trumpet on multiple takes of Minority ':
,: are to be admired and imitated at a certain point in any jazz :,
: trumpeter s development. :
:' ':
,: In high school, I found the recordings of trumpeter Nicholas :,
: Payton, especially the album From This Moment, melodically :
:' intoxicating with such a defined vibe in the groove. Based on ':
,: Payton s interpretation of the composition You Stepped Out of a :,
: Dream, Dream Steps attempts to drift the listener away from :
:' everyday life through a journey of melodic pathways and ':
,: energetic shifts. :,
